How do you increase the response on a 2a throw?
« on: January 22, 2011, 08:15:21 PM »

i recently received a pair of raiders through a trade, and i want to make it more responsive. any tips?

Or for a quick fix, tie a Green Triangle around the bearing.  It won't be as good as a properly modded Raider, but it's MUCH easier (and reversible).

A small amount of thick lube in the bearing will greatly increase responce.

This is definitely the best answer.  Its not even a bad idea to use lip balm thickness lube (petroleum jelly) as it will work out slowly, and allows your throw to progress with you.
